  • Wizard
5 hours ago, xYoussifer said:

Also because of FOV I can't do same distance with my mouse when ADSing, its way less distance than on Warzone, how can you be sure that I have the right sens if ingame you can't do the same distance on mousepad?

You are matching movement to a specific point on the monitor, like in this example which is MDH 100% meaning the same movement to the edge of the monitor:

Matching 360 distance for scopes makes no sense in is impossible in most games since it would require a very high sensitivity.

5 hours ago, xYoussifer said:

Is it bad to have 2.3 margin of error (13 centimeters)? The x15 scopes represents nearly 100% of that margin of error, so the sens must be kinda off

1.5% off isn't ideal, but it's not big enough to make a huge difference.
